The Benefits of Home Cycling
Convenience and cycle exercise home Flexibility
One of the most substantial benefits of home biking is the convenience it provides. There's no need to take a trip to a fitness center or wait on beneficial weather conditions. You can cycle at any time, whether it's early in the morning or late during the night, fitting your exercises around your hectic schedule.
Controlled Environment
Home cycling permits you to manage the environment. You can adjust the temperature level, lighting, and volume of your music to create the perfect exercise environment. This can improve your focus and enjoyment, leading to more effective workouts.
Low-Impact Exercise
Biking is a low-impact activity, making it ideal for individuals with joint concerns or those recuperating from injuries. It supplies a mild yet efficient way to burn calories and enhance cardiovascular health.
Mental Health Benefits
Routine exercise, consisting of cycling, has actually been revealed to reduce stress, stress and anxiety, and depression. Home biking can be a relaxing and meditative experience, assisting you preserve a favorable mental state.
Cost-Effective
While acquiring a stationary bicycle for exercise at home can be an initial investment, it is frequently more affordable than a fitness center membership in the long run. Plus, you conserve on travel time and expenditures.
Needed Equipment for Home Cycling
To start your home biking journey, you'll need a few important pieces of equipment:
Stationary bicycle
Upright Bikes: These are comparable to traditional roadway bikes and are great for beginners or those who choose a more upright posture.
Recumbent Bikes: These bikes offer a reclined seating position, which is simpler on the back and more comfy for longer rides.
Spin Bikes: These are designed for high-intensity workouts and simulate the experience of a spin class.
Resistance Bands and Hand Weights
These can be utilized to add range to your exercises and target various muscle groups.
Heart Rate Monitor
A heart rate monitor can help you track your strength and guarantee you're working within your target heart rate zone.
Water Bottle and Towel
Remaining hydrated and having a towel for sweat are vital for any exercise equipment.
Comfortable Clothing
Wear breathable, moisture-wicking clothing to remain comfy throughout your sessions.

Reliable Home Cycling Workouts
There are numerous types of cycling workouts you can carry out in your home, each targeting different aspects of fitness. Here are some popular options:
Steady-State Cycling
Description: Ride at a moderate rate for a longer duration, normally 20-60 minutes.
Benefits: Improves cardiovascular health, burns calories, and enhances endurance.
Tips: Maintain a constant heart rate and concentrate on your form and breathing.
High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T).
Description: Alternate between brief bursts of extreme effort and periods of recovery.
Example Routine:.
Warm-up: 5 minutes at a moderate speed.
Periods: 30 seconds at high intensity, followed by 30 seconds at a low intensity (repeat 10-15 times).
Cool-down: 5 minutes at a moderate pace.
Advantages: Boosts metabolic process, enhances cardiovascular fitness, and burns a considerable variety of calories in a short time.
Hill Climbs.
Description: Simulate climbing up hills by increasing the resistance on your bike.
Example Routine:.
Warm-up: 5 minutes at a moderate pace.
Hill Climb: 10 minutes with increased resistance.
Flat Road: 5 minutes at a moderate pace.
Hill Climb: 10 minutes with increased resistance.
Cool-down: 5 minutes at a moderate rate.
Advantages: Builds leg strength, enhances endurance, and obstacles your cardiovascular system.
Tabata Training.
Description: A type of HIIT that involves 20 seconds of high-intensity effort followed by 10 seconds of rest, repeated 8 times.
Example Routine:.
Warm-up: 5 minutes at a moderate speed.
Tabata: 20 seconds of high strength, 10 seconds of rest (repeat 8 times).
Cool-down: 5 minutes at a moderate rate.
Advantages: Extremely reliable for burning fat and enhancing aerobic and anaerobic fitness.
Endurance Rides.
Description: Longer trips at a moderate to challenging rate, typically 45-90 minutes.
Advantages: Builds endurance, enhances psychological durability, and burns a considerable number of calories.

FAQs About Home Cycling.
Q: What are the best stationary bicycles for home usage?
A: Some of the best stationary bikes for home use consist of the Peloton Bike, NordicTrack Commercial S 22i Studio Cycle, and the Schwinn IC4 Indoor Cycling Bike. These bikes offer a mix of functions, from interactive classes to adjustable resistance, to match various requirements and budget plans.
Q: How typically should I cycle in your home?
A: For general physical fitness, objective to cycle 3-5 times per week. If you're training for a specific event or goal, you might require to cycle more often. Constantly listen to your body and allow for sufficient rest and healing.
Q: Can home cycling aid with weight reduction?
A: Yes, home cycling can be an efficient tool for weight-loss. It helps burn calories, enhance metabolic process, and construct muscle, which can add to weight loss when combined with a healthy diet and other kinds of exercise.
Q: Is home cycling as efficient as outdoor biking?
A: While the experience may vary, home biking can be similarly effective in terms of fitness advantages. The secret is to maintain a constant and difficult routine, comparable to what you would do outdoors.
Q: How do I prevent dullness with home cycling?
A: To avoid monotony, attempt blending up your exercises, signing up with virtual cycling classes, or developing a playlist of your preferred music. You can likewise set little goals or difficulties to keep yourself inspired.
Q: What should I do if I feel discomfort while biking?
A: If you experience discomfort, stop the workout instantly and examine your bike setup. Make sure the seat and handlebars are adjusted properly to prevent stress. If discomfort continues, seek advice from a healthcare professional.
